ABSTRACT

This chapter explores two pilot projects in which approaches from the citizen science (CS) movement are brought into conversation with the aims of Responsible Research and Innovation. Two very different technoscientific issues are addressed here: Endometriosis and waste collection practices. However, outside their immediate local context, the pilots serve another important purpose, namely as good examples of the use of CS within a well-established context of innovation for societal transformation, with deep roots in the Catalan society.
